Overview
- Gonzaga moved to 4-0 with a double-digit victory in Tempe in front of 10,016 spectators.
- Graham Ike scored 20 points with nine rebounds and went 12-for-15 at the free-throw line.
- Tyon Grant-Foster posted 14 points and 12 rebounds after a Spokane County judge’s injunction restored his eligibility.
- Arizona State was hampered by second-half technical fouls on Santiago Trouet and coach Bobby Hurley as Gonzaga dominated the glass 45-31 and won the foul-line battle 25-of-31 to 13-of-23.
- Former Sun Devil Adam Miller hit consecutive late 3-pointers to push the lead to 67-52; next up are Gonzaga vs. No. 8 Alabama on Nov. 24 in Las Vegas and ASU vs. Georgia State on Monday.
